Novel computer radiator fan
Technical field
This utility model relates to a kind of computer heat radiating device, more precisely, be a kind of novel computer radiator fan.
Background technology
Along with improving constantly of computing power, the heat dispersion of computer also needs to improve constantly.Existing fan cooling many employings vertical ventilation structure, air quantity is limited, and radiating effect is not good enough.
Utility model content
This utility model mainly solves the technical problem existing for prior art, thus provides a kind of novel computer radiator fan.
Above-mentioned technical problem of the present utility model is mainly addressed by following technical proposals:
A kind of novel computer radiator fan, it is characterized in that, described novel computer radiator fan comprises a fixed part and a fan portion, described fixed part comprises a tetragonal fixed frame, the bottom of described fixed frame is provided with a motor liner plate, the inwall of described fixed frame is provided with a vortex board array being made up of vortex board, described fan portion comprises a driving motor, the described circumference driving motor is provided with the array of vanes of a blade composition, the edge of described blade is respectively equipped with an eddy current breach, described eddy current breach matches with described vortex board, a current stabilization arc groove array being made up of the current stabilization arc groove of arc it is respectively equipped with on the upper surface of described blade.
As this utility model preferred embodiment, described vortex board is arranged on the inwall of fixed frame obliquely.
When novel computer radiator fan of the present utility model has the advantage that use, after driving electric motor starting, the eddy current breach of blade edge can form, at the afterbody of blade, the eddy airstream that a spiral is descending, eddy airstream relends and helps vortex board to blow to obliquely on radiating surface, compare vertical ventilation, these obliquely vortex air-supply substantially increase air supply areas, substantially increase radiating efficiency.It addition, utilize the current stabilization arc groove on the upper surface of blade, can effectively reduce the noise of blade high-speed rotation, improve the comfortableness of the use of radiator fan.This novel computer cooling fan structure is simple, with low cost, and effect is obvious, practical.

Detailed description of the invention
Below in conjunction with the accompanying drawings preferred embodiment of the present utility model is described in detail, so that advantage of the present utility model and feature can be easier to be readily appreciated by one skilled in the art, thus protection domain of the present utility model is made apparent clear and definite defining.
As shown in Figures 1 to 4, this novel computer radiator fan 1 comprises fixed part 2 and a fan portion 3, this fixed part 2 comprises a tetragonal fixed frame 21, the bottom of this fixed frame 21 is provided with a motor liner plate 22, the inwall of this fixed frame 21 is provided with a vortex board array being made up of vortex board 23, this fan portion 3 comprises a driving motor 31, the circumference of this driving motor 31 is provided with the array of vanes of blade 32 composition, the edge of this blade 32 is respectively equipped with an eddy current breach 34, this eddy current breach 34 matches with this vortex board 23, a current stabilization arc groove array being made up of the current stabilization arc groove 33 of arc it is respectively equipped with on the upper surface of this blade 32.
This vortex board 23 is arranged on the inwall of fixed frame 21 obliquely.
During use, as depicted in figs. 1 and 2, after driving motor 31 to start, the eddy current breach 34 at blade 32 edge can form, at the afterbody of blade 32, the eddy airstream that a spiral is descending, eddy airstream relends and helps vortex board 23 to blow to obliquely on radiating surface, compare vertical ventilation, these obliquely vortex air-supply substantially increase air supply areas, substantially increase radiating efficiency.
It addition, utilize the current stabilization arc groove 33 on the upper surface of blade 32, can effectively reduce the noise of blade high-speed rotation, improve the comfortableness of the use of radiator fan.
This novel computer cooling fan structure is simple, with low cost, and effect is obvious, practical.
